    DWF Viewer aX control fails to build

    Hi,

     

    I am trying to add the DWF Viewer to a WinForms project in Visual Studio 2010.  As my machine is x64bit, I've changed the project properties under compile/advanced comp.../Target CPU to x86bit.  I can add the control just fine, but as soon as I try to build Visual Studio crashes.  I've tried targeting .Net Framework 3.5, but had the same issue.  Design Review works fine on my computer, so I'm thinking that this should work.

     

    Any thoughts on what else I should try?

    Thank you.  Creating a user control in VS 2008 Express Target Framework 2.0 with the DWF viewer and then using the dll in VS 2010 works well.
